About Pao‐Hsin Liao

Pao‐Hsin Liao is a scholar working on Otorhinolaryngology, Oral Surgery and Complementary and alternative medicine, having authored 12 papers that have together received 367 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(3 papers),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(2 papers) and Head and Neck Cancer Studies (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Periodontics (64 citations), General Dentistry (14 citations) and Otorhinolaryngology (27 citations). Pao‐Hsin Liao has collaborated with scholars based in Taiwan,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include Ming‐Yung Chou, Suh‐Woan Hu, Chi‐Chiang Yang, Chien-Fu Huang, Shih-Shen Lin, Kuo‐Wei Tai, Yu‐Chao Chang, Yu‐Feng Huang, Hui‐Wen Yang and Randy Todd. Their work appears in journals such as Oncogene, Phytotherapy Research and Oral Oncology.
